8.3 NTP
The real-time clock of the device is set in the window "NTP" (Network Time Protocol) .
A real-time clock which can be synchronised via NTP is integrated in the device . If several devices are
used, it is ensured via NTP that the real-time clocks of the devices run synchronously .
►
Click on the [NTP] window .
> The settings in the "NTP" window are displayed:
